Think of it as more than just a place to drop your pup off. For active breeds like the hunting dogs common in our area, or energetic herding dogs, daycare provides essential physical and mental stimulation. Instead of being cooped up alone, they get to socialize and play in a safe, supervised environment. This means they come home happily tired, not bored and destructive. It’s a game-changer for preventing those lonely behaviors, especially during planting or harvest season when our schedules get extra hectic.
Now, let’s talk about the ‘spa’ part. This isn’t about frivolous pampering; it’s about essential care with a local touch. Our Mississippi environment brings unique challenges: red clay stains from a romp in the fields, ticks and fleas in the warm months, and pollen that can irritate sensitive skin. A professional spa service handles the messy cleanup so you don’t have to, using high-quality shampoos that can soothe allergies and medicated baths for pest prevention. A thorough deshedding treatment can also be a blessing for keeping your home cleaner, especially during seasonal coat blows.
For New Site pet owners considering a daycare and spa, here’s some practical advice. First, visit the facility. A good one will be transparent and welcome you to see where the dogs play and rest. Ask about their staff-to-dog ratio and how they group playmates by size and temperament. Inquire about their grooming products—do they offer options for sensitive skin common in some breeds? Many local services will even provide report cards or photos, so you can see your happy pup having fun while you’re at work.
